Pat LaVarre wrote:
> kernel: ata_scsi_dump_cdb: CDB (2:0,0,0) 12 00 00 00 24 00 00 00 46
> kernel: ata_scsi_translate: ENTER
> kernel: ata_sg_setup_one: mapped buffer of 36 bytes for read
> kernel: ata_fill_sg: PRD[0] = (0x46EE54, 0x24)
> kernel: ata_dev_select: ENTER, ata2: device 0, wait 1
> kernel: ata_tf_load_pio: feat 0x5 nsect 0x0 lba 0x0 0x0 0x0
> kernel: ata_tf_load_pio: device 0xA0
> kernel: ata_exec_command_pio: ata2: cmd 0xA0
> kernel: ata_scsi_translate: EXIT
> kernel: atapi_packet_task: busy wait
> kernel: atapi_packet_task: send cdb
> kernel: ata_host_intr: BUS_DMA (host_stat 0x24)
> kernel: ata_dma_complete: ENTER
> kernel: ata_dma_complete: host 2, host_stat==0x24, drv_stat==0x50
> kernel: ata_sg_clean: unmapping 1 sg elements
> kernel: ata_scsi_dump_cdb: CDB (2:0,0,0) 12 00 00 00 c0 00 00 00 46
> kernel: ata_scsi_translate: ENTER
> kernel: ata_sg_setup_one: mapped buffer of 192 bytes for read
> kernel: ata_fill_sg: PRD[0] = (0x46EE54, 0xC0)
> kernel: ata_dev_select: ENTER, ata2: device 0, wait 1
> kernel: ata_tf_load_pio: feat 0x5 nsect 0x0 lba 0x0 0x0 0x0
> kernel: ata_tf_load_pio: device 0xA0
> kernel: ata_exec_command_pio: ata2: cmd 0xA0
> kernel: ata_scsi_translate: EXIT
> kernel: atapi_packet_task: busy wait
> kernel: atapi_packet_task: send cdb
> kernel: ata_host_intr: BUS_DMA (host_stat 0x24)
> kernel: ata_dma_complete: ENTER
> kernel: ata_dma_complete: host 2, host_stat==0x24, drv_stat==0x50
> kernel: ata_sg_clean: unmapping 1 sg elements
> kernel:   Vendor: Iomega    Model: RRD               Rev: 74.B
> kernel:   Type:   CD-ROM                             ANSI SCSI revision: 00
> kernel: ata_scsi_dump_cdb: CDB (2:0,1,0) 12 00 00 00 24 00 00 00 46


This is some amount of success, as libata appears from this dump to have 
successfully handled a data-transferring SCSI command (INQUIRY).
